I saw it and I think the judges were correct. It happened with about 200m to go as Brown jumped off
Lancaster's wheel, right into McEwen (who was holding his line). Brown said he had to go somewhere,
but it was a pretty wild move. Hard call, but if Lancaster had moved to his right, then he would
have got in the way of Cooke.
Brownie really doesn't like McEwen any more. He was surprisingly calm about it afterwards though, as
was happy that he did actually cross the line in front of him.
